Install XNet in GDLauncher

XNet runs on NeoForge, Forge. Pick whichever your existing instance uses, or create a new one. GDLauncher installs the correct loader automatically.

Install on NeoForge

  1. Open GDLauncher and create a new instance (the + button on the Library page).
  2. Pick the NeoForge loader and a Minecraft version that XNet supports (1.21.1, 1.20.1, 1.19.4 are common choices).
  3. Open the new instance, go to the Addons tab, and click Add Addons.
  4. Paste the Quick Install ID #xnet, find XNet in the results, and hit Download. GDLauncher pulls dependencies automatically.
  5. Hit Play. That's it.
